A number is chosen randomly from numbers 1 to 60. The probability that the chosen number is a multiple of 2 or 5 is ______.
पर्याय
`2/5`
`3/5`
`7/10`
`9/10`

A number is chosen randomly from numbers 1 to 60. The probability that the chosen number is a multiple of 2 or 5 is `underlinebb(3/5)`.
Explanation:
Let us suppose A: Number is multiple of 2.
Let us suppose B: Number is multiple of 5.
Then n(A) = 30
n(B) = 12
n(A ∩ B) = 6
⇒ P(A or B) = P(A) + P(B) – P(A and B)
⇒ P(A or B) = `30/60 + 12/60 - 6/60 = 36/60`
⇒ P(A or B) = `3/5`
